Luke 12:10

And everyone who speaks a word against the Son of Man will be forgiven, but the person who blasphemes against the Holy Spirit will not be forgiven.

Matthew 12:31-32

For this reason I tell you, people will be forgiven for every sin and blasphemy, but the blasphemy against the Spirit will not be forgiven.

1 John 5:16

If anyone sees his fellow Christian committing a sin not resulting in death, he should ask, and God will grant life to the person who commits a sin not resulting in death. There is a sin resulting in death. I do not say that he should ask about that.

1 Timothy 1:13

even though I was formerly a blasphemer and a persecutor, and an arrogant man. But I was treated with mercy because I acted ignorantly in unbelief,

Mark 3:28-30

I tell you the truth, people will be forgiven for all sins, even all the blasphemies they utter.

Luke 23:34

[But Jesus said, "Father, forgive them, for they don't know what they are doing."] Then they threw dice to divide his clothes.

Hebrews 6:4-8

For it is impossible in the case of those who have once been enlightened, tasted the heavenly gift, become partakers of the Holy Spirit,

Hebrews 10:26-31

For if we deliberately keep on sinning after receiving the knowledge of the truth, no further sacrifice for sins is left for us,
